Longhorn Transformation Pack To the Ultimate Transforming description Download

Want to change the looks of your Windows XP and make it look like the upcoming Microsoft Longhorn?

This is another brand new release of the one and only Longhorn Transformation Pack.

This small piece of software will transform your Windows XP (and SP2) or Windows Server 2003 into the best looking Longhorn port that is available right now, without any extra software!

Requirements:
Windows XP (SP1/SP2) or Windows 2003

What's New in This Release:

· Added contributed skin "Western (By Scott Eichelberger)"
· Added first-run slient transforming mode for automatic transformation and uninstallation (perform when Windows starts)
· Added Longhorn Transformation Pack - Maintenance Center (No more keeping full package to waste diskspace)
· Added Rolando's Longhorn's MSN Messenger 6.2 and 7.0 skins (Aero UI and Longhorn Inspriat)
· Fixed "February" and "December" month name error in Longhorn Tile
· Fixed manual transformation bug for non-relative path launch (such as running apply.bat from address bar)
· Fixed username text-size bug in Aero (Longhorn Glass) theme from Longhorn Aero
· Updated compression software (save up little bit more space)
· Updated E-Mail and website information
· Updated more information regarding Before Transformation dialog and Themes service
· Updated logo brand image (It's 2005 now)
